If this sounds like you, DEBRA has a fantastic Store Manager opportunity waiting for you in Orpington You will be working full-time, 35 hours a week across 5 days (out of 7), and for your dedication, you will be rewarded with a salary of £26,954.20 per year. We ae looking for someone who is truly driven, positively bursting with enthusiasm, and exceptionally skilled at delivering first-class customer service. You will need to be well-organised with retail administration and manual handling tasks, possess strong management abilities, customer service acumen, creative flair (for example designing shop window displays), and the ability to remain calm under pressure to achieve targets and ensure our Orpington shop operates smoothly and efficiently. This role will encompass a diverse range of duties to keep the shop running like clockwork, from the physical handling of stock and donations to the confident use of both our internal systems and external platforms. You will need to be comfortable and confident working with computers, as well as with team members and independently. Why work for us here at DEBRA We offer a competitive salary, along with rewards & benefits which include: Auto enrolment Pension with DEBRA contribution, Life Assurance Scheme, Employee Assistance Program which offers 24/7 access for staff and their families, Generous Training Budget (DEBRA has a learning culture and supports and encourages Employee Voice), Career Progression for your continued personal development journey, Annual Leave 20 days plus Bank Holiday (pro rata for part time employees), Increased Holiday Entitlement and Long Service Awards, Exclusive Staff Discount, Personalised Recognition Awards, Opportunities for Apprenticeships and Internships.
